#9e4d44 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9e4d44 is composed of 62% red, 30.2%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.3% magenta, 57%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 6 degrees, a saturation of 39.8% and a lightness of 44.3%. #9e4d44 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9a88 with #3d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#9e4d44 color description : Dark moderate red.
#9e4d44 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9e4d44 has RGB values of R:158, G:77,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.57,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10374468.

Shades and Tints of #9e4d44
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070303 is the darkest color, while #fcf9f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9e4d44
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#73706f is the less saturated color, while #db1c07 is the most saturated one.
